英英释义

To pay taxes means to fulfill one's legal obligation by remitting a portion of income or profits to the government, which is used for public services and infrastructure.

缴税是指履行法律义务,将收入或利润的一部分交给政府,用于公共服务和基础设施建设。

To pay duty refers to the act of paying a specific tax imposed on certain goods or products, usually when they are imported or exported, to regulate trade and raise revenue.

缴纳关税是指对某些商品或产品支付特定税费的行为,通常是在进出口时,以调节贸易和增加收入。

In modern society, the concept of financial responsibility is paramount. One of the most significant responsibilities that individuals and businesses face is the obligation to pay taxes; pay duty. These terms refer to the contributions made to the government, which are essential for the functioning of public services and infrastructure. Understanding the importance of these payments can help citizens appreciate their role in society and the economy.Firstly, when we talk about pay taxes; pay duty, we are referring to the mandatory financial charges imposed by the government on its citizens. Taxes can take various forms, including income tax, sales tax, property tax, and corporate tax, among others. Each type of tax serves a specific purpose and contributes to the overall revenue that the government uses to fund public services such as education, healthcare, and transportation.The importance of paying taxes; paying duty cannot be overstated. Without these funds, governments would struggle to provide essential services that benefit everyone. For instance, public schools rely heavily on state and local taxes to operate. If citizens fail to meet their tax obligations, it could lead to cuts in educational programs, larger class sizes, and even school closures. Similarly, healthcare services, which are often funded through taxes, would be severely impacted, leading to a decline in the quality of care available to the public.Moreover, paying taxes; paying duty is not just a civic duty; it is also a legal requirement. Failing to comply with tax regulations can result in penalties, fines, and even legal action. This highlights the necessity for individuals and businesses to understand their tax obligations thoroughly. Many people seek the assistance of tax professionals to ensure they fulfill their responsibilities accurately and on time.Another crucial aspect of paying taxes; paying duty is the concept of social equity. Taxes are often structured in a progressive manner, meaning that those with higher incomes contribute a larger percentage of their earnings compared to those with lower incomes. This system is designed to promote fairness and reduce income inequality within society. When everyone contributes according to their means, it helps create a more balanced economy, where resources can be allocated more equitably.Additionally, paying taxes; paying duty fosters a sense of community. When individuals see their tax dollars at work—whether it’s through improved roads, better schools, or enhanced public safety—they are more likely to feel connected to their community and invested in its success. This connection can lead to increased civic engagement, where citizens become more active in local governance and decision-making processes.In conclusion, the obligation to pay taxes; pay duty is a fundamental aspect of citizenship that supports the functioning of society. It is essential for funding public services, ensuring social equity, and fostering community spirit. By understanding the significance of these payments, individuals can appreciate their role in contributing to the greater good and promoting a thriving society. Therefore, fulfilling this responsibility should be viewed not just as a legal obligation but as a vital part of being an engaged and responsible citizen.
